A mentor-protégé joint venture is the instrument that lets a large business compete for work it is otherwise barred from bidding. That single sentence explains why contracts and corporate development teams keep returning to it, and why so many of these ventures are formed badly. The structure is not complicated, but it is unforgiving: the ownership split, who manages, how the work divides, whose past performance counts and who the key personnel are all have to hold together, and the first bid is where any inconsistency shows up.
This is written for the person at a prime who has to form one: a contracts lead, a corporate development director, or a capture executive who has decided a set-aside pursuit is worth a venture rather than a pass. It covers what the structure has to satisfy, what each party actually contributes, and the engineering work that determines whether the venture's first technical volume reads like a real capability or like two firms stapled together.
What the venture is for, stated precisely
An unpopulated joint venture between an SBA-approved mentor and its protégé can pursue contracts set aside for the protégé's small business category, and the mentor's size does not disqualify the venture through affiliation. That exception is the whole mechanism. Without the approved mentor-protégé relationship behind it, a joint venture with a large partner is generally treated as affiliated and loses the small business status the set-aside requires.
Three consequences follow immediately and they govern everything downstream. The mentor-protégé agreement has to be approved before the venture bids, not in parallel with the proposal. The venture is an entity, and it needs its own registration, its own identifiers and its own written agreement in place before an offer. And the venture is formed to pursue specific work, so the entire structure should be designed against the actual solicitations on the capture list rather than as a general-purpose vehicle.
Teams that skip that last point produce a venture agreement written in generalities, then discover at proposal time that the workshare split, the key personnel, or the past performance story does not fit what the solicitation asks for. Reverse the order. Read the target solicitations first, then write the agreement so it answers them.

The structural rules the agreement has to satisfy
Six constraints shape every mentor-protégé joint venture. Read the current regulation text and the solicitation before relying on any general description, including this one, because the details move and the contracting officer will apply the version in force.
Ownership and control sit with the protégé. The small business partner holds majority ownership of the venture. That is not a formality: it drives who signs, who controls the venture's decisions, and how the venture is treated on size and status.
One party manages, and it is the protégé. The venture agreement designates the small business as the managing venturer, and names an employee of that firm as the project manager responsible for performance. This is where teams that intend a large-partner-led arrangement discover the structure does not permit it. If the prime's real intent is to run the program, a joint venture is the wrong instrument and a subcontract is the right one.
The protégé performs a required share of the work. There are limits on how much of the venture's work the mentor may perform, expressed against the work the venture itself performs. The practical effect is that the protégé's engineering has to be real and substantial, which is why protégé selection and venture formation are the same problem.
Profits follow work. The agreement states how profits are divided, and the division is expected to track the work each party performs rather than being negotiated as pure equity return.
The venture keeps its own books and records. Bank account, accounting, and the ability to produce performance-of-work records for the contract. This is the obligation most often underestimated, because it means the venture is an operating entity and not a name on a signature page.
The agreement is written before the offer and amended per contract. Ventures typically need contract-specific addenda that describe, for each award, the responsibilities of each party, the equipment and facilities each furnishes, and the specific work division. Writing one generic agreement and reusing it unchanged is a common and avoidable finding.
| Question | Mentor-protégé joint venture | Prime with subcontractor | Teaming agreement only |
|---|---|---|---|
| Can it bid a small-business set-aside | Yes, with the approved mentor-protégé relationship behind it | Only if the prime itself qualifies | Only if the prime itself qualifies |
| Who holds the contract | The venture, as a distinct offeror | The prime | The prime, once formed |
| Who manages performance | The protégé, through a named project manager | The prime | The prime |
| How work divides | By the venture agreement, within performance-of-work limits | By subcontract scope, negotiable | By intent, until the subcontract is signed |
| Whose past performance can be offered | Both parties', with each role stated | Prime's, with the sub's cited for its scope | Prime's, with the sub's cited for its scope |
| Formation cost and time | Highest: entity, registration, agreement, addenda | Low: an existing subcontracts process | Lowest: a document |
| Best fit | A set-aside pursuit worth a multi-year relationship | Full and open work needing specialist scope | Early capture, before commitment |
Past performance and key personnel, the two evaluation questions
These are where a venture's first proposal is won or lost, and where inexperienced ventures get careless.
On past performance, a joint venture that has no record of its own is normally evaluated on what its members bring. The practical rule for the proposal writer is not to hide the seams. Present each cited contract with the party that performed it named, the role that party held, and the specific relevance to the scope this venture will do. An evaluator who can see which firm did which work, and can map it to the work division in the venture agreement, is an evaluator who can score it. An evaluator who reads a blended narrative and cannot tell who did what will discount it or ask.
The strongest presentation ties the citations to the workshare. If the protégé owns the AI and data engineering scope, the protégé's citations should be about models and pipelines delivered into production, described with the same vocabulary the technical approach uses. If the mentor owns program management, systems integration and the accreditation lift, the mentor's citations should be about programs of that size and shape. When the citations line up with the division of work, the venture reads as designed rather than assembled.
On key personnel, the constraint is blunt: name people who exist, whose availability has been confirmed, and who will actually appear. The project manager is an employee of the managing venturer, and the solicitation may impose its own qualifications for that role and others. Substitution after award is a known irritant to program offices and a known source of protest arguments. If the person named cannot be committed for the period, name a different person.
What each party actually contributes on an AI or data pursuit
The generic answer is that the mentor brings scale and the protégé brings agility, which is a sentence that has never won a technical volume. On this kind of work the contributions are specific and they should be written that way.
What the mentor typically brings. Program management at the size the government is buying, and the internal machinery that goes with it: earned value if the contract requires it, subcontract administration, and a delivery process that has survived audits. Systems integration into the agency's existing environment, including the networks, identity, and enterprise services that a specialist firm has not seen. The accreditation lift, including the security engineering staff who write bodies of evidence and know the assessors. Facilities and enterprise tooling. And the institutional relationships that make schedule risk manageable when an approval stalls.
What the protégé typically brings. The engineering that the pursuit is actually about: the data model, the pipelines, the model development and evaluation, the application the users touch. Speed, because a small engineering team makes decisions in hours. Modern practice, because a firm whose whole existence depends on delivering software tends to have infrastructure as code, automated tests, and a deployment that runs from a clean checkout. And a technical narrative written by the people who will do the work, which reads differently from a narrative written by a proposal team.
The division that works is by system layer rather than by phase. Splitting a program into "the mentor does design and the protégé does build" produces a handoff and a fight. Splitting it so one party owns the data platform and the model lifecycle end to end, and the other owns integration, accreditation and program delivery end to end, produces two teams that can each be held to a result.
The engineering that makes the first bid credible
A venture's first technical volume has a specific weakness: nothing has been built together. The way to overcome that is to describe an architecture with enough precision that an evaluator can tell it came from engineers rather than from a template. On AI and data work, five things carry that weight.
The data layer, described as a contract. Not "we will ingest data from agency systems," but which systems, what the interface is, how often it changes, what the venture does when a schema changes without notice, and what validation runs at ingest. State the failure behavior explicitly: the pipeline halts, an alert reaches a named role, and no downstream consumer receives partial data. Evaluators who have been burned by a silent pipeline recognize this paragraph immediately.
The model lifecycle, described as artifacts and gates. Training data versioned and retained, models versioned as artifacts, a held-out evaluation set, a threshold agreed before the run, a comparison against a simple baseline, and a documented promotion decision. Then the reverse path: how a bad model is rolled back, and how the system identifies which model version produced a decision made three months ago. This is the paragraph that separates firms that have operated a model from firms that have trained one.
The human path, described as interface behavior. What the user sees when the model is uncertain, how a wrong output is reported in one click, where that report goes, and how it becomes evaluation data. Federal users will not adopt a system that gives them answers with no recourse, and program offices know it.
The security and authorization path, described as inheritance. Which boundary the system lives in, which platform services are already authorized, what the venture inherits and what it must document itself, who writes the evidence, and where in the schedule the assessment sits. Naming the inheritance is what shows the venture has done this rather than read about it.
Operations, described as who gets paged. What is monitored beyond uptime: data freshness, distribution shift, error rates by segment, and queue depth. Which role responds, what the runbook says, and how a fix reaches production. A technical volume that ends at go-live is a technical volume written by people who have never operated anything.
Write those five sections with the protégé's engineers holding the pen and the mentor's proposal manager editing for evaluation fit. The reverse order produces prose that is compliant and says nothing.

What the venture cannot do, and when to use something else
A joint venture is expensive to form and carries real administration, so it should be reserved for pursuits where it is the only path or a decisive advantage. Three situations argue against it.
When the prime intends to control performance. The structure puts management with the protégé. A prime that will not accept that should use a subcontract, where control is ordinary and the relationship is simpler.
When the work is full and open. If the prime can bid it directly, the venture adds structure without adding eligibility. Bring the specialist in as a named subcontractor with scored scope instead.
When the relationship is untested. Forming a venture with a firm you have never delivered with is a bet placed at maximum stakes. Run a subcontract on a live program first, at a size where a bad outcome costs a quarter rather than a program, then form the venture with evidence.

Forming it without losing the pursuit
The sequence matters because a venture formed under proposal pressure is a venture formed badly. Approved mentor-protégé relationship first, well before the target solicitation. Then read the actual solicitations and write the venture agreement to them. Then the entity, the registration, the bank account and the accounting so the venture can operate. Then the contract-specific addendum for the pursuit, with the work division, the responsibilities of each party, and what each furnishes. Then the proposal, with past performance mapped to the work division and key personnel confirmed.
Two habits prevent most of what goes wrong. Have the same person read the venture agreement and the technical volume side by side before submission, checking that the work division, the citations, the key personnel and the technical approach all describe the same arrangement. And keep the performance-of-work records from the first day of performance rather than reconstructing them when someone asks.
Bottom line
A mentor-protégé joint venture is worth forming when a set-aside pursuit matters enough to justify an entity, and it works when the structure and the story agree. The protégé owns the majority, manages the venture, names the project manager, and performs a substantial share of the work, so the protégé's engineering has to be real. Divide the work by system layer rather than by phase so each party owns a result. Present past performance with each party's role named and mapped to that division. Name key personnel who will actually appear. And let the engineers write the architecture sections, in the detail that shows a data contract, a model lifecycle with gates, a human path, an inherited authorization boundary, and an operations plan with a named responder. A venture whose paperwork and technical volume tell the same story reads as designed. One that does not reads as assembled, and evaluators notice.
